电话远程控制系统设计

上传人:aa****6 文档编号:38381058 上传时间:2018-05-01 格式:DOC 页数:17 大小:298KB
返回 下载 相关 举报
电话远程控制系统设计_第1页
第1页 / 共17页
电话远程控制系统设计_第2页
第2页 / 共17页
电话远程控制系统设计_第3页
第3页 / 共17页
电话远程控制系统设计_第4页
第4页 / 共17页
电话远程控制系统设计_第5页
第5页 / 共17页
点击查看更多>>
资源描述

《电话远程控制系统设计》由会员分享,可在线阅读,更多相关《电话远程控制系统设计(17页珍藏版)》请在金锄头文库上搜索。

1、电话远程控制系统设计电话远程控制系统设计1 系统方框图系统方框图1.11.1 系统组成系统组成系统结构方框图如下:图 1.1 1.21.2 系统工作原理系统工作原理电话远程控制系统的原理方框图如图1.1所示:系统由电话振铃检测模块,阻抗匹配电路,DTMF译码模块,晶振复位电路模块,以及微处理器五大部分组成。系统以AT89S51作为核心控制器件,MT8870为DTMF信号的接收电路,在系统程序的控制下实现远程控制功能。它适用于家庭、商店等无人的场所,还可以用于工业控制现场,它通过电话控制各种空调和家用电器,并可以连接防探头实现自动报警,同时该系统提供对各种空调未端设备的控制。以电话作为媒介, 通

2、过电话线完成对设备的远程操作。此电话远程控制系统的工作原理如下:由于该系统并接在家用电话的两端,且不影响到电话机的正常工作,因此出门在外的人,可以通过拨打家中的电话号码,交换机向家中电话机发送振铃信号,当有振铃信号进来的时候,该系统的振铃检测电路接收到铃流信号时,单片机的定时/计数器 T1 开始计数,当计数的次数达到10次时,计数器溢出向CPU申请中断,当CPU响应中断请求后,置P1.4为低电平,启动模拟摘机电路,实现自动摘机。接通线路后,再通过解码芯片MT8870及一些外围元器件组成的解码电路,将双音频信号转化为相应的二进制号码,从该芯片的Q1Q4端口传振铃检 测模块微 处 理 器 AT89

3、C51摘挂机控 制电路DTMF译 码模块语音存储模块驱动电路电器电话线驱动电路电器功放阻 抗 匹 配 电 路电 话 机电 源2送到AT89S51的P1.0、P1.1、 P1.2、P1.3 口,通过P1口将该二进制数读入并保存在数据RAM区,又单片机控制的相应的发光二极管亮灯。用户可以根椐自己的需求,进行下一步的操作,如不需要,既可挂机结束本次远程控制操作。2 设计方安设计方安2.12.1 时钟复位电路设计时钟复位电路设计2.1.1 复位电路设计复位电路设计单片机复位是使 CPU 和系统中的其他功能部件 都处在一个确定的初始状态,并从这个状态开始工作,例如复位后 PC=0000H,使单片机从第一

4、个单元取指令。复位电路一般有上电复位、手动开关复位等电路,如图 1.2 所示。其中 RET 输出电压必须在 2V 以上,C3 极性电容充电放电必须维持在 2 个机器周期以上。一般 R11 和 C3 的取值为 2K、22uF。在此我们选择 图 2.1 复位电路手动开关复位电路。2.1.2 时钟电路时钟电路在 MCS-51 芯片内部有一个高增益反相放大器,其输入端为芯片引脚XTAL1,其输出端为引脚 XTAL2 。而在芯片的外部,XTAL1 和 XTAL2 之间跨接晶体振荡器和微调电容,构成一个稳定的自激振荡器,这就是单片机的时钟电路,时钟电路产生的振荡脉冲经过触发器进行二分频之后,才成为单片机的

5、时钟脉冲信号。时钟信号电路如图 1.3 所示。图 2.2 时钟电路其中 C4 和 C5 的取值一般在 20pF40pF 间,在此设计中我们取 30pF,晶振为 12MHz。Y12MC430C530C322uFSWR11 2K+5GN DAXTL1XTAL232.22.2 振铃检测电路设计振铃检测电路设计如下图1.4所示,该电路是以光耦合器件为核心组成的,当有铃流信号进来,此信号通过光耦合器件,给发光二极管一个电压,从而使光耦合器件工作,输出方波信号到 P3.3 口,供主控部分的检测1。口口口口12J1A1K2C3E4U1R2 10KP33D5IN4001+5C1 22FR1 15K图 2.3

6、振铃检测电路2.2.1 电路设计思路电路设计思路 由于在电话线上没有摘机之前,电话线的两端是4860V的直流电压信号。当电话线上无振铃信号时,该系统不会工作。当有铃流信号进来,程控交换机送来的是253HZ的正弦交流电压信号,其PP为9015V,信号以1秒送、4秒断的形式发送,振铃检测可以有多种形式,但是最常用的是采取光耦合器件来实现的,由于它的优点在于可以使输入与输出在电气(电源、地线)上完全绝缘,具有很高的抗干扰性。而在该电路中,它作为一个开关器件和信号隔离的作用。同时具有很高的耐压值可达到5001000V,以及价格便宜,设计简单,工作可靠等优点。只要在程序部分进行振铃次数的检测,设置在一定

7、次数的振铃后再摘机,提高了系统的稳定性。2.2.2 元件选取元件选取(1) 隔直电容C1的选取隔直电容C1是电解电容,用于过滤直流,滤出低频信号,而且振铃信号的电压还比较高,在这里采用22F耐压100V的钽或铝解电容。(2) 电阻R1的选取电阻R1是起限流作用,保证光耦合器件的正常工作,因为电话线的阻值4小到一定值时,便会在电话环路内形成动作电流(程控电话交换机检测到环路电流突变大于30mA,即认为用户己摘机) ,会影响电话线路的正常工作。所以此处取15k。(3) 稳压二极管D1的选取稳压二极管D5 为光耦器件进行保护而设计的。它并接于光耦的两端,当信号的正半周期加在光耦的两端使其导通,当负半

8、周期使光耦截止,可经此该二极管续流,从而保护光耦不会电压过大而损坏,这样就要求光耦要有良好的耐压性能。此处采用1N4001。(4) 光耦U1的选取光耦是一种光电信号的耦合器件,它是一种将发光二极管和光敏三极管封在一起的器件。通过光信号耦合,使夹杂在输入开关量中的各种干扰脉冲都挡回在输入回路的一侧。光耦具有较高的电气隔离和抗干扰能力,对地电位差干扰有很强的抑制能力,而且有很强的抑制电磁干扰能力。速度高、价格低、接口简单、体积小、寿命长等优点。选取型号为TIL系列的P621。2.32.3 阻抗匹配电路设计阻抗匹配电路设计阻抗匹配电路如图1.5所示。 在未摘机之前,P1.4端为高电平,该电路处于未工

9、作状态,当振检铃测电路检测到十次振铃时,P1.4输出低电平,Q2管导通,从而Q1的 基极变为低电平也使Q1导通,Q1的 集电极经电阻R7和发光二极管组成回路 图 2.4 阻抗匹配电路 形成大约 300 的电阻,电流为 30mA 的恒流源,使回路电流变大,控制电路向交换机发出模拟摘机的信号,交换机响应摘机信号,实现电话线路接通。整个电路完成自动模拟摘机过程。2.3.1 阻抗匹配电路元件的选取阻抗匹配电路元件的选取极性保护电路 D1 的选取:当程控交换机确认有摘机信号时,送来的是直流信R454KR510KR7 1KR3100R610KD6口口口口Q1 2N5401Q2 2N5551D3 1N400

10、1D41N4001D1 1N4001D2 1N400112J1A1K2C3E4U2P14+55号,但是电话线哪一端为正,哪一端为负。为了解决这一问题,电话机中都装有极性保护电路,这样做可以使不确定的极性变成确定的极性,经其变换后再与电路的其它部分相连,起到了必要的保护作用。本电路选取的 4 个二极管的型号为 1N4004。高压三极管 Q1 及开关管 Q2 的选取: 接在电话线路中的三极管一般都选择耐高压的三极管,该电路也考虑到电话线上的电压有时可能会出现很高的情况,所以选用了高压三极管。从程控交换技术手册可以了解,摘机时电话线两端的电压为 811V 左右,环路阻抗要小于 2K(600 时比较合

11、适) ,环路电流要在 30mA 左右。三极管 Q1 的主要作用就是充当恒流源,需选用 PNP 型的三极管。本电路选取的是 2N5401。而三极管 Q2 起到开关的作用,当加高电平时,处于饱和导通状态,当低电平时,处于截止状态.本电路选取 2N5551。 2.42.4 音频解码电路设计音频解码电路设计2.4.1 DTMF 解码芯片解码芯片MT8870DTMF 信号接收器又称为 DTMF 解码器,它的功能是把 DTMF 信号变换为二进制数字信号。利用这些数字信号借助逻辑电路进行控制,在程控电话系统中它往往接在交换机中。目前双音多频产品多属于 CMOS 集成产品,国际上一些主要器件产品厂商或公司均有

12、代表性的 DTMF 接收器。如 MITEL 公司MT8870、M8870、MH88305 与 MK5091 等。这些 DTMF 产品集成度高、体积小、抗干扰能力强,并且中间传输的是两个音频信号,最后输出的是二进制编码信号,便于与微型计算机接口。本系统选取的 MT8870 是 MITEL 公司生产的 DTMF 信号接收器,是COMS 大规模集成电路芯片, MT8870 的内部集频带分离滤波器与数字解码功能为一体,滤波部分用开关电容技术,分成高频群及低频群滤波器,解码器使用数字计数器技术检测把全部 16 个 DTMF 音调解码成四位二进制码。由于它内部有差动放大器、时钟振荡器和锁存三态总线接口,所

13、以减少了该集成电路外部器件的数目。MT8870 共有18个引脚,引脚分布如图1.6所示。MT8870引脚功能如下:IN+:运算放大器同相输入端;IN-:运算放大器反相输入端;GS:增益选择,它为内部运算放6大器输出端与前端连接反馈电阻提供通道;VREF:基准电压输出端,标准值VDD/2用来给内部运放输入端加偏置;INH、PWDN:内部连接端,大多接到VSSDSC1、2:时钟输入端及时钟输出端,这两脚之间接一个3.MHz的石英晶体组成内部振荡电路。VSS:负电源输入端,大多数情况该端接公共地。TOE:三态输出使能输入端,该端为逻辑高时使能Q0-Q3有输出。Q1-Q4:三态数据输出端,当TOE为使

14、能时,提供与最接近接收到的有效音调对相对应的四位二进制码。STD:延时导引输出端,当一个被收到的音调对已被寄存并且锁存器的输出已被校正时,该端为逻辑高,当St/GT端电压降到低于VRS时,该端转变为逻辑低。EST:早期导引输出端,表示有效音调频率的检测。一旦数字算法检测到一个有效的音调(信号状态) ,该端就出现高电平,信号状态的任何减小将导致EST转换为逻辑低。ST/GT:导引输入/保护时间输出。它是一个双向端,STD检测出一个大于VTSt的电压,器件寄存所检测到的音调对并校正锁存器输出;STD端检测出一个小于VTSt 的电压,器件自由地接收一个新的音调对。GT输出的作用是重复外部导引时间常数

15、。VDD:正电源输入端,规定VDD 为+5V。2.4.2 微处理器微处理器由于是用于小产品的设计,要求体积小、功耗小、容易控制,我选择了我最熟悉的AT89S51。(1)AT89S51主要技术指标3AT89S51与MCS-51系列的单片机在指令系统和引脚上完全兼容。AT89S51是一种低损耗、高性能、CMOS八位微处理器。片内有4k字节在线可重复编程快擦写程序存储器;全静态工作,工作范围:0Hz24MHz;1288位内部RAM;图 2.5 MT8870 的引脚分布IN+1 IN-2 GS3 VREF4 INH5 PD WN6DSC17 DSC28VSS9TO E10Q111Q212Q313Q41

16、4ST D15EST16ST /GT17VD D18732位双向输入输出线;两个十六位定时器/计数器;五个中断源,两级中断优先级;一个全双工的异步串行口。(2) AT89S51引脚功能:AT89S51单片机共有40引脚,其分布如图1.7所示。 图 2.6 AT89S51 P0口是三态双向口,通称数据总线口,因为只有该口能直接用于对外部存储器的读/写操作。P3口与 P1、P2口不同,它具有第二功能。 2.4.3 MT8770 与与 AT89S51 单片机的接口电路单片机的接口电路MT8870电路的基本特性是实现DTMF信号分离、滤波和译码功能,输出相应的16种DTMF频率组合的4位并行二进制码。电路输出的二进制码Q1Q4由数据输出允许端TO

展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 大杂烩/其它

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号